crit
kriht
noun
1
Informal short form of "criticism" or "critique," especially in creative or academic settings.
"The art students gathered for a group crit of each other's work."
2
In games, short for a "critical hit" — an attack that does extra damage.
"She landed a crit and finished off the boss."
How to Use Crit
Learner’s notesIn plain EnglishShorthand for a critique/criticism session, or (in gaming) a lucky extra-damage hit.
When to use it
Informal in both senses.

Etymology
A shortened form of "criticism," "critique," or "critical hit," depending on context.
